In 2026, the global supply chain for PC parts continues to face significant disruptions due to geopolitical tensions, transportation issues, and manufacturing delays. These challenges have led to increased prices and limited availability, prompting consumers and businesses to adopt strategic approaches to secure essential components.

Understanding the Supply Chain Challenges

The supply chain disruptions in 2026 are multifaceted. Key factors include:

  • Global geopolitical tensions affecting trade routes and manufacturing hubs
  • Transportation delays due to port congestion and limited shipping capacity
  • Manufacturing shortages caused by factory shutdowns and resource scarcity
  • Increased demand for PC components driven by remote work and gaming trends

Effective Deal Strategies for Consumers

Consumers seeking PC parts during these times should consider several strategies to maximize value and availability:

Regularly tracking prices and market fluctuations helps identify the best times to purchase. Use price comparison tools and subscribe to alerts from reputable retailers.

2. Explore Alternative Brands and Models

Opt for less popular or emerging brands that may offer comparable performance at lower prices. Flexibility in model selection can also improve availability.

3. Consider Used or Refurbished Parts

Certified refurbished or used PC components can be a cost-effective alternative. Ensure they come with warranties and are purchased from trusted sources.

Strategies for Retailers and Distributors

Retailers and distributors need to adapt to the supply chain disruptions with innovative deal strategies:

  • Establish relationships with multiple suppliers to diversify sourcing
  • Implement dynamic pricing models that reflect market conditions
  • Offer pre-orders or reservations to secure inventory in advance
  • Provide bundled deals to increase sales and move stock efficiently

4. Leverage Technology and Data Analytics

Using data analytics helps predict demand patterns and optimize inventory management, reducing the risk of stockouts and excess inventory.

Long-Term Planning and Investment

Both consumers and businesses should consider long-term strategies to mitigate ongoing supply chain issues:

  • Invest in higher-quality, durable components to reduce replacement frequency
  • Build relationships with local suppliers to shorten supply chains
  • Stay informed about technological advancements and upcoming product releases
  • Allocate budget for potential price surges and shortages

Adopting these deal strategies can help navigate the complex landscape of PC parts supply in 2026, ensuring better value and availability despite ongoing disruptions.
